Dragon joins BII for Annual Lunch

31-Jan-2007

 

BII, the professional body for the licensed retail sector, will be holding its Annual Lunch on 1 May 2007 at the The Grosvenor House Hotel, Park Lane, London. This year the keynote speaker will be Simon Woodroffe, famous as the founder of Yo! Sushi and also as one of the ‘dragons’ on the BBC2 Dragon’s Den TV programme.
